Paper Summary:

This paper discusses Russian born filmmaker Andrei Tarkovsky's film "Nostalghia". It is compared and contrasted with Hamid Nacify's notion of accented cinema in which culture plays a influential part in filmmaking. Tarkovsky's films are characterized by metaphysical themes, extremely long takes, and memorable images of exceptional beauty. The paper shows that recurring motifs in his films are dreams, memory, childhood, running water accompanied by fire, rain indoors, reflections, and characters re-appearing in the foreground of long panning movements of the camera.

From the Paper:

"Compared to other forms of art that have been around for thousands of years (i.e. paintings and drawings, cinema is relatively new and has only been around for the past century. The first films came out in the 1890s and were shown first in theatres in the United States, France, Germany, and Great Britain (Binkowski 70). By the early 1900s, the cinema had spread to all parts of the world through the development of advanced technology (Taylor 166). Watching a film at the cinema soon became one of the most popular forms of entertainment that reached audiences throughout the world in large cities and in urban sprawls."
